Hi! My name is Melanie, Josh's older sister.  I'll be sharing updates here as we love on and support the Morones family through the journey ahead.

The next few days definitely feel like hazing week. Seven medical appointments, a port placement, and two kiddos with their own (pre-scheduled) surgeries. Between all the heavy adulting, there's also the strange adjustment of saying taboo words like cancer and chemotherapy, words that still feel foreign and sharp in the mouth. They become a little more real each time a phone call turns into an appointment, another piece of equipment is introduced, or another reminder appears that this unexpected chapter has truly begun.

Last week, we spent time building this page, trying to think through possible needs and imagine the unimaginable. There were plenty of moments of laughter mixed in. Devyn cracking jokes, all of us wondering aloud what terrible karmic offense she and Josh must have committed in a previous life to be handed such a wonky health onion in this one. (If you know them, you know humor is part of how they cope.)

One thing I heard clearly from Josh and Devyn was how deeply grateful they are for the incredible support system surrounding their family. As we all buckle down and lean into community while Devyn kicks cancer's ass, please know that every meal, message, well-wishing, gift card, ride, and kind word matters more than you know. Thank you for showing up for them, and for reminding them they aren't riding this ride alone.
